Urge incontinence
Correct Answer: C
Rationale: Urge incontinence is caused by bladder spasms and contractions, leading to sudden, uncontrollable urges to urinate.

Overflow incontinence
Correct Answer: D
Rationale: Overflow incontinence occurs when the bladder does not empty fully due to an obstruction, causing leakage.

Functional incontinence
Correct Answer: A
Rationale: Functional incontinence results from physical or cognitive inability to reach the bathroom in time.

Total incontinence
Correct Answer: F
Rationale:
Total incontinence involves continuous urine leakage without warning or control.

Neuropathic incontinence
Correct Answer: B
Rationale: Neuropathic incontinence occurs when nerve damage prevents the brain from receiving signals that the bladder is full.
